Introduction
Rise Vision is a free cloud based Content Management Solution (CMS). With Rise Vision Player already integrated into Userful, users can play digital signage contents created on Rise Vision CMS platform. Through Rise Vision session container; a user can play, schedule and assign multiple contents to different displays from the video wall setup.
Mapping: Creating Rise Vision Player Source
Mapping allows you to bind a display or video wall to Rise Vision Player source. To create this source:
- Click on Mapping > New Source. From the drop-down menu select "Rise Vision Player" as the preferred source type and give a name
- Enter the Claim ID (Claim ID can be found under Settings tab under Rise Vision account)
- Set the height and width of your presentation. The presentation values (height and width) must be same as of your Rise Vision presentation
- Click "OK" to complete the process
Map Displays to Rise Vision Player Source
Once the source has been created, displays or video wall can be "mapped" or assigned to the Rise Vision source by simply dragging-and-dropping the desired displays or video wall icons to the source.
To edit (e.g., change icon or Claim ID) or delete the source, simply click on the source name to access the Edit Source window and make the changes.
Note: Changes will not take effect until the "Apply" button is clicked.
